Project 1453: Increasing Resilience to Climate Change and Natural Hazards in Vanuatu


Project Title
Increasing Resilience to Climate Change and Natural Hazards in Vanuatu
Project Description

To help increase the resilience of communities in Vanuatu to the impacts of climate variability and change and natural hazards on food and water security as well as livelihoods.  Specifically (i) institutional strengthening for climate change adaptation and disaster risk management; (ii) promotion of improved technologies for food crop production and resilience to climate change and (iii) improved rural water security.

Notes

US$11.52M Dec 2012 – Dec 2018
